so if i buy it, you suggest that I just slowly learn to drive it?? I understand what you're saying, but getting a brand new car, and not being able to drive it feels like a sin to me. But I still like how it is AWD and a sedan. The problem is that if I buy it, somebody else that I know will have to drive it home. I'm sure I can find somebody to do that, but i will feel weird not being able to drive it.
Do you have any special suggestions for operating the clutch for me, because like I said, I do know how to drive a manual, I only had problems starting from a stop, but I could shift fine. In the worst case scenario, what if I don't get the hang of it, and end up not liking it? Has anybody else had this same problem or is it just me?? thanks |
|
#10
|
||||
|
||||
|
Just give it a lot of gas. It will want to bog down more than a 2wd, so just give it more gas than you think you need to, and slip the clutch more than you think. Then work your way down from there till you find the right balance. I had the same problem when I got rid of my Civic and got this car. You'll get used to it.
